Sathish.KcreationComplete only fires once when the SWFLoader is created. Therefore you never reset your variables to point to the new sub-app. On a slow network, creationComplete may fire before the sub-app loads. It is best to use the COMPLETE event.

Hi Chris,
I have been working with SWF loader on the SAP portal using the BICS connection type. It was not supported last time I asked about a year ago. However, it can work if you specify the URL in the SWF loader in this way:
http://sapwebdisp.vestas.net:8103/bicsremotebex?SWF=XXX&TIMESTMP=1318867468000
XXX is the name you publish your child dashboard under. Data can be exchanged between the parent and child dashboard by using the custom component "Data sharer" from Inovista which can be downloaded for free:
http://www.inovista.com
Besides the fact that this setup is unsupported there are some limitations so from my point of view it should only be applied under the following conditions:
1. It is not possible to build eveything into a single dashboard.
2. A solution having several independent dashboards does not make sense.
An alternative might be the setup described in note 1526291. The way I understand it, it binds the dashboards together in a similar way as on a BO server with flash variables.

You can't change size dynamically as it is defined by the
object embed tags.
You could use WMODE transparency which could help you fake it
tho not always best
solution to go with WMODE. It's a very buggy parameter.
WMODE will remove the background color so the flash movie
appear over the html and you
can see the HTML content trough the movie.
You could define some solid shape for the background on
bottom layer to make it look
like SWF background, than change it with the other loaded
movie making it appear as it
changed size while the over all flash size stats the same. As
said above - faking it.
